Banque Cantonale Vaudoise increased its stake in shares of Marriott International, Inc. (NASDAQ:MAR - Free Report) by 283.6% in the first qu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The firm owned 3,905 shares of the company's stock after purchasing an additional 2,887 shares during the period. Banque Cantonale Vaudoise's holdings in Marriott International were worth $1,277,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Other institutional investors and hedge funds also recently added to or reduced their stakes in the company. Wellington Management Group LLP boosted its position in Marriott International by 21.7% in the 3rd quarter. Wellington Management Group LLP now owns 9,175,377 shares of the company's stock valued at $2,389,635,000 after buying an additional 1,637,119 shares during the period. Invesco Ltd. increased its position in shares of Marriott International by 2.7% during the fourth quarter. Invesco Ltd. now owns 4,440,359 shares of the company's stock worth $1,377,577,000 after acquiring an additional 118,504 shares during the period. Capital International Investors raised its stake in shares of Marriott International by 7.1% in the fourth quarter. Capital International Investors now owns 4,107,531 shares of the company's stock valued at $1,274,475,000 after acquiring an additional 272,250 shares in the last quarter. Norges Bank purchased a new position in Marriott International in the fourth quarter valued at $812,570,000. Finally, Price T Rowe Associates Inc. MD grew its stake in Marriott International by 13.2% during the 4th quarter. Price T Rowe Associates Inc. MD now owns 1,879,028 shares of the company's stock worth $582,952,000 after purchasing an additional 219,579 shares in the last quarter. Hedge funds and other institutional investors own 70.70% of the company's stock.

Marriott International Trading Down 0.4%

Shares of MAR stock opened at $377.31 on Friday. The company has a market capitalization of $99.49 billion, a P/E ratio of 39.59,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 3.00 and a beta of 1.10. The business's 50 day moving average is $374.03 and its two-hundred day moving average is $343.18. Marriott International, Inc. has a twelve month low of $253.76 and a twelve month high of $410.98.

Marriott International (NASDAQ:MAR -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 6th. The company reported $2.72 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$2.56 by $0.16. Marriott International had a net margin of 9.72% and a negative return on equity of 80.97%. The business had revenue of $1.81 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$6.59 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$2.32 earnings per share. The business's revenue was up 6.2% compared to the same quarter last year. Marriott International has set its FY 2026 guidance at 11.380-11.630 EPS and its Q2 2026 guidance at 2.990-3.060 EPS. As a group, equities analysts predict that Marriott International, Inc. will post 11.64 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Marriott International Increases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, June 30th. Investors of record on Friday, May 22nd will be given a dividend of $0.73 per share. The ex-dividend date is Friday, May 22nd. This represents a $2.92 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.8%. This is an increase from Marriott International's previous quarterly dividend of $0.67. Marriott International's payout ratio is presently 30.64%.

Insider Transactions at Marriott International

In related news, EVP Peggy Roe sold 3,000 shares of the business's stock in a transaction dated Monday, May 18th. The shares were sold at an average price of $361.56, for a total value of $1,084,680.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the executive vice president owned 19,827 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$7,168,650.12. The trade was a 13.14%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which can be accessed through this hyperlink. Insiders own 11.43% of the company's stock.

Analysts Set New Price Targets

A number of analysts recently weighed in on MAR shares. Wells Fargo & Company upped their target price on shares of Marriott International to $446.00 and gave the stock an "overweight" rating in a research note on Thursday, May 7th. JPMorgan Chase & Co. raised their price objective on shares of Marriott International from $356.00 to $383.00 and gave the company a "neutral" rating in a report on Tuesday, April 21st. Barclays boosted their target price on shares of Marriott International from $372.00 to $376.00 and gave the stock an "equal weight" rating in a research note on Thursday, May 7th. Sanford C. Bernstein set a $412.00 price objective on Marriott International in a report on Monday, June 15th. Finally, Truist Financial boosted their target price on Marriott International from $350.00 to $356.00 and gave the stock a "hold" rating in a research note on Tuesday, May 26th. Eight equities research anal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ating and eight have assigned a Hold rating to the company. According to MarketBeat, the stock has a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us price target of $384.73.

Marriott International Profile

(Free Report)

Marriott International is a global lodging company that develops, manages and franchises a broad portfolio of hotels and related lodging facilities. Its core activities include hotel and resort management, franchise operations, property development and the provision of centralized services such as reservations, marketing and loyalty program management. The company's brand architecture spans market segments from luxury and premium to select-service and extended-stay, enabling it to serve a wide range of business and leisure travelers as well as corporate and group customers.
